Title :
A back-projection method for near infrared tomography
Author :
Zhang, K. ; Rolfe, P. ; Houston, R. ; Carson, K. ; Wickramasinghe, Y ; Fans, F.
Author_Institution :
Dept. of Biomed Eng & Med Phys, Keele Univ., Stoke-on-Trent, UK
fDate :
Oct. 29 1992-Nov. 1 1992
Abstract :
A back-projection algorithm has been developed to reconstruct the CT images using near infrared laser as the light source. It assumes that the area to which the measurement is most sensitive is the one around the line linking the optical transmitter and detector.
